Remove an Item From an Array
A utility to remove items that match a specified value from an array. Works recursively to remove items from nested arrays.
Install
npm i remove-item-from-array --save
Usage
removeArrayItem(arr, item)
The module exports a function; the first argument is the current array, the second is the value of items that should be removed.
Examples
import removeArrayItem from "remove-item-from-array";
const arr = removeArrayItem(["cat", "dog", ["cat", "goose"]], "cat");
// arr will be ['dog', ['goose']]
You can also pass additional values as arguments to remove multiple items in one statement:
const arr = removeArrayItem(["cat", "dog", ["goose"]], "cat", "dog");
// arr will be [['goose']]
